wordpress MYSQL query to select/delete posts based on date and category

Following is sample mysql query to use against wordpress database to select or delete posts based on date from particular category of posts
delete a,b,c,d FROM wp_posts a LEFT JOIN wp_term_relationships b ON ( a.ID = b.object_id ) LEFT JOIN wp_postmeta c ON ( a.ID = c.post_id ) LEFT JOIN wp_term_taxonomy d ON ( d.term_taxonomy_id = b.term_taxonomy_id ) LEFT JOIN wp_terms e ON ( e.term_id = d.term_id ) WHERE e.term_id =1 and a.post_date < '2011-08-01'
